Jessica S.
8/13/2022
Great customer service, large selection, and god location. Would definitely recommend this store.
(1)
Great customer service, large selection, and god location. Would definitely recommend this store.
Partial Data by Infogroup (c) 2025. All rights reserved.
Partial Data by Foursquare.